Coconut production plays an important role in the national economy of india. According to figures published in december 2009 by the food and agriculture organization of the united nations, india is the world's third largest producer of coconuts, producing 10, 894, 000 tonnes in 2009. Traditional areas of coconut cultivation in india are the states of kerala, tamil nadu, karnataka, puducherry, andhra pradesh, goa, maharashtra, odisha, and west bengal and the islands of lakshadweep and andaman and nicobar. As per 2014-15 statistics from coconut development board of government of india, four southern states combined account for almost 90% of the total production in the country: tamil nadu (33.84%), karnataka (25.15%), kerala (23.96%), and andhra pradesh (7.16%). Other states, such as goa, maharashtra, odisha, west bengal, and those in the northeast (tripura and assam) account for the remaining productions. Though kerala has the largest number of coconut trees, in terms of production per hectare, tamil nadu leads all other states. In tamil nadu, coimbatore and tirupur regions top the production list. In goa, the coconut tree has been reclassified by the government as a palm (like a grass), enabling farmers and real estate developers to clear land with fewer restrictions.

Coconut shells are also used as water scoops and as materials for handicrafts. Coconut fire Coconut fiber is used as rope, rope, carpet, brush, boat mosaic as well as as a filler material; It is also widely used in gardening as a filler in fertilizer.
